Warby Parker Fall 2016 Collection

Chicago IL location

I’m excited to help announce today’s launch of Warby Parker’s Fall 2016 collection! The folks at Warby Parker were kind enough to give me an inside look and I would like to share a few of my favorites with you.

If you’re unfamiliar with Warby Parker they are a glasses company that design their own glasses in-house to essentially give you the “wholesale” price. Their stores are not only stocked with beautiful glasses & sunglasses, but books as well. Also for every pair sold, a pair is distributed to someone in need.

First up and personally my favorite is their Mixed Materials collection. This collection features rounded frames with metal accents plated in 18-karat white gold or 24-karat gold.

On Him: Moriarty in Jet Black (plated in white gold) / On Her: Tansley in Jet Black (plated in gold)
A closer look at the Tansley in Jet Black plated in 24-karat gold
 
Not sure what it is, but for me black & gold paired together is such a winning combination. It makes the item (whatever it happens to be) so versatile. The gold bridge on these glasses add just enough glam for a very chic yet classic look.

Hadley in Violet Magnolia (plated in gold)

This season also features a beautiful Fall Palette collection showcasing classic frames in shades reminiscent of fall.

On Him: Percey in Scarlet Tortoise / On Her: Casey in Melon

Chelsea in Violet Magnolia
A closer look at the Chelsea in Violet Magnolia

Nothing could be more classic and feminine than a pair of cat-eye glasses in a tortoiseshell shade. I just love the twist on these, with a hint of violet that would pair nicely with blue or brown eyes.

And lastly, I would love to introduce you to their Basso Fall collection. A signature of Warby Parker where they join two layers of acetate together and then carve away part of the top layer to show what’s underneath.

Duckworth in Cognac Tortoise with Cashew

Ashby in Cognac Tortoise with Melon
Ashby in Cognac Tortoise with Bermuda Blue

The Basso collection (carved away look) is something I’ve never seen before, but can easily see why it’s become their signature look. I love the tortoise outline on these glasses giving them a delicately framed cat-eye look. Blue and brown are another winning combination and this Bermuda Blue is such a lovely light and airy blue.
